Specs Of Sony Cyber-shot DSC-HX200V
- Manual functions and Superior Auto Mode
- Background Defocus and Photo Creativity interface
- 3.0 inch XtraFine LCD Display
- With 18.2 MP Exmor R CMOS sensor
- GPS and 10 fps continuous shooting
- Carl Zeiss Vario-Tessar lens with 30x optical zoom
- Intelligent Sweep Panorama and Artistic Picture Effect modes
- Digital Level Gauge and Sweep Panorama High Resolution
- ISO 100-12800
- Come with Full 1080p HD video Shooting
My Canon Sony DSC-HX200V Review

Surface and Handling
Sony Cyber-shot DSC-HX200V is not a heavy DSLR, i can’t feel the weight when i put it in my hand. The camera body is black and has a solid and metal build. You can find the programmable Custom button on top of this camera which is a attentive design.
The tilting 3.0 inch XtraFine LCD Display is 921,000-dots resolution that is higher than many similar products.

Do You Like The Performance?
The key feature of Sony Cyber-shot DSC-HX200V is can shoot high ISO images with only a few noise, The main reason why this camera can do this great job is the assistant of Carl Zeiss Vario-Tessar lens with 30x optical zoom and 18.2 MP Exmor R CMOS sensor.
With 1080P video which has the 60 frames per second recording speed, The video quality of HX200V works like a charm. As you know, i find a lot of camera has the lower recording speed and most of these has only 720P modes.
How about the battery life. After tested, You can take about 450 images until the batteries drained.
